Background
My interest in yoga and meditation began in my late teenage years. Meditation had a dramatic effect on my life, whilst yoga felt very much like a 'coming home', that put me in touch with my ancestral heritage.
I have been teaching yoga and meditation in Cheltenham and Gloucester for many years as a British Wheel of Yoga Teacher. I studied at the International Meditation Centre (UK), in the tradition of Sayagyi U Ba Khin, the respected Burmese Teacher, also with a variety of British Wheel of Yoga Teachers and I have studied Kum Nye Meditation with Maura and Franklyn Sills, Directors of Karuna Institute, Devon. My teaching has developed over 30 years of practise and from working with a variety of wonderful teachers and students.
I teach regular weekly classes and one to one sessions, and have taught yoga for the local college (Gloscat), as well as run corporate classes for businesses.
I have a background in Stress Management Counselling and training natural health practitioners in Polarity Therapy. Polarity Therapy is a broad based approach to health, incorporating, nutrition, acupressure bodywork and exercise.
Yoga and meditation continue to be an essential part of my life.
